A winning combination of an attractive shrub and edible berries make the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ry a great choice for any garden. Known botanically as Vaccinium corymbosum 'NC4499', this blueberry bush produces interesting blue-green foliage and small white flowers, which later develop into delicious fruits. With a final height of 3 to 4 feet, the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ry is a versatile shrub. 

The deciduous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ry forms a rounded habit and is winter hardy in zones 6 to 9. It will develop berries on its own but planting alongside another Highbush variety will ensure a bumper crop. Splendid!™ is ideal for mass plantings and forming a low hedge. It can also be grown as a specimen in a border. 

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ry Care

Full sun is needed for the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ry to thrive and develop ripe berries. It prefers an acidic substrate that is fertile and free draining. Water well after planting, and keep the soil moist during the spring and summer. To give it a boost, you can apply an ericaceous-specific fertilizer in early spring. Mulching annually with organic matter will help conserve moisture over the hotter months. 

No pruning is required for the first 4 to 6 years. From then on, you can remove some of the oldest wood to encourage new growth. 

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ry Spacing

The Splendid!™ Blue Highbush Blueberry can reach a final size of 3 to 4 feet tall and wide. If planting multiple shrubs, a spacing of 3 to 4 feet between plants is appropriate.
